Title The Effect of the Belt and Road Initiative on China's Soft Power in Kyrgyzstan
Summary China’s Belt and Road Initiative (BRI) is seen as one of its most ambitious projects to boost its international influence. This thesis explores the effect of BRI on the public perception of China. Kyrgyzstan, where the public opinion of China is worse than anywhere else in the Central Asian region, is chosen as a case study. The framework of the thesis relies on the conceptualization of soft power outlined by Joseph Nye and extended to also include economic resources. Using available survey results on public opinion on China and semi-structured expert interviews, this paper argues that China’s application of soft power through BRI is negatively perceived by the general population in Kyrgyzstan. The reasons behind and the impact of the negative perception are further discussed in the thesis.
